
The Compass
The organizing structure of The Meeting is a compass—a floor installation that guided visitors through the 2023 Savage Mystic exhibition and continues to serve as a conceptual map for the project as a whole. The compass is built from the Vesica Piscis shape, oriented to true north, and divided into four quadrants. Each quadrant corresponds to an archetype, a cardinal direction, a value, and a stage in what Mallory calls “the journey of a thought.”

That journey unfolds as:
I am not → I don’t → I can’t → I won’t → I should → I could → I will → I do → I am
The cycle then repeats.
Each pair of statements (e.g., “I do” / “I don’t”) anchors one archetype’s light and shadow.
The four archetypes were developed because the existing Jungian and feminine archetype frameworks felt, in the artists’ words, “too male, too binary, too cringe.” Rather than critique from the outside, Mallory and Lyndsey built their own scaffold, rooted in lived experience, dream work, nervous system research, and the specific iconography of Reno.
